AUGUSTA, Ga.-Entered into rest Thursday, April 15, 2004, at his residence. SFC retired, Andrew Belser Sr., of Hummingbird Lane, Augusta. Funeral services will be conducted Wednesday, April 21, 2004, at 11 a.m., from Greater Young Zion Missionary Baptist Church with Rev. William B. Blount...
